The Styles of Rifle Scopes
Rifle scopes can be either “first focal plane” or “second focal plane” type of scopes. The type of focal plane an optic has establishes where the reticle or crosshair is located relative to the optic’s magnifying adjustments. It actually indicates the reticle is located behind or ahead of the magnifying lens of the scope. Choosing the most desired form of rifle optic depends on what sort of shooting or hunting you anticipate doing.
Info on First Focal Plane Optics
First focal plane optics (FFP) feature the reticle ahead of the magnification lens. This causes the reticle to increase in size based on the level of zoom being used. The benefit is that the reticle measurements are the same at the enhanced range as they are at the non magnified distance. For example, one tick on a mil-dot reticle at one hundred yards without any “zoom” is still the corresponding tick at 100 yards with 5x “zoom”. These types of scopes work for:
- Quick acquisition, long distance kinds of shooting
- Shooting circumstances where computations are very little
- Experienced shooters who have an idea for their aim point “hold over” and also “lead” ratios for their weapon
- Shooters who don’t mind the reticle is bigger and takes up more visual eyesight space than a SFP reticle
About Second Focal Plane Scopes
Second focal plane scopes (SFP) come with the reticle to the rear of the magnifying lens. This causes the reticle to stay at the exact same size relative to the amount of magnification being used. The result is that the reticle dimensions adjust based upon the zoom chosen to shoot over lengthier ranges due to the fact that the reticle measurements present various increments which fluctuate with the zoom level. In the FFP illustration with the SFP scope, the 5x “zoom” 100 yard tick reticle measurement would be 1/5th of the non “zoom” tick measurement. These sorts of glass work for:
- Long distance kinds of shooting where shooters have more time to make ballistic estimations
- Shooting where most shots happen within shorter ranges and spaces
- Shooters who would like a clearer optic picture without room taken up by the larger size FFP reticle
Ins and Outs of Optic Zoom
The quantity of magnification a scope provides is identified by the diameter, thickness, and curvatures of the lenses inside of the rifle scope. The magnification of the scope is the “power” of the scope.
Fixed Single Power Lens Glass
A single power rifle optic and scope comes with a zoom number designator like 4×32. This suggests the magnification power of the scope is 4x power while the objective lens is 32mm. The magnification of this type of optic can not adjust since it is a fixed power scope.
Variable Power Lens Glass
Variable power rifle scopes use variable power levels. The power adjustment is performed by making use of the power ring part of the scope near the rear of the scope by the eye bell.

Single Covering Versus Multi-Coating
Various optic lenses can even have different finishings applied to them. All lenses generally have at least some kind of treatment or finish applied to them prior to being used in a rifle scope or optic. This is due to the fact that the lens isn’t just a raw piece of glass. It becomes part of the carefully tuned optic. It needs to have a finish put on it so that the lens will be optimally functional in numerous kinds of environments, degrees of sunshine (full light VS shade), and other shooting conditions.
Single coated lenses have a treatment applied to them which is generally a protective and boosting multi-purpose treatment. This lens treatment can protect the lens from scratches while decreasing glare and other less beneficial things experienced in the shooting environment while sighting in with the scope. The quality of a single covered lens depends on the scope producer and how much you spent paying for it. Both the manufacturer and amount are signs of the lens quality.
Some scope producers likewise make it a point to specify if their optic lenses are covered or “multi” coated. This implies the lens has several treatments applied to the surfaces. If a lens receives multiple treatments, it can prove that a manufacturer is taking several actions to combat various environmental elements like an anti-glare finishing, a scratch resistant anti-abrasion finish, followed by a hydrophilic covering. This also doesn’t necessarily mean the multi-coated lens is much better than a single coated lens. Being “better” depends on the producer’s lens treatment solutions and the quality of components used in creating the rifle scope.

Rifle Scope Installation Options
Mounting solutions for scopes are available in a few options. There are the basic scope rings which are separately installed to the scope and one-piece scope mounts which cradle the scope. These different types of mounts also normally come in quick release variations which use throw levers which enable rifle operators to quickly install and dismount the scope.
Hex Key Optic Rings
Basic, clamp-on design mounting scope rings use hex head screws to position to the flattop style Picatinny scope mounting rails on rifles. These kinds of scope mounts use a pair of detached rings to support the optic, and are made from 7075 T6 billet aluminum which are developed for long distance precision shooting. This kind of scope mount is ideal for rifle systems which require a resilient, hard use mount which will not change no matter just how much the scope is moved or abuse the rifle takes. These are the type of mounts you really want to have for a faithful optics system on a reach out and touch someone hunting or hard target interdiction long gun that will hardly ever need to be altered or adjusted. Blue 242 Loctite threadlocker can also be used on the mount screws to keep the hex screw threads from backing out after they are mounted securely in place. An example of these rings are the 30mm style made by the Vortex Optics company. The set normally costs around $200 USD
Quick-Release Cantilever Scope Ring Mounting Solutions
These types of quick-release rifle scope mounts can be used to quickly attach and detach a scope from a rifle before reattaching it to a different rifle. Multiple scopes can also be swapped out if they all use a compatible style mount. These types of mounts come in handy for rifle platforms which are transferred a lot, to swap out the optic from the rifle for protecting the scope, or for scopes which are used between numerous rifles.
Sealing and Gas Purging for Glass Tubes
Moisture inside your rifle glass can destroy a day on the range and your expensive optic by triggering fogging and creating residue inside of the scope’s tube. Many scopes prevent wetness from entering the optical tube with a system of sealing O-rings which are water resistant. Normally, these water resistant scopes can be immersed within 20 or 30 feet of water before the water pressure can force moisture past the O-rings. This should be sufficient moisture prevention for basic use rifles, unless you intend on taking your rifle aboard watercrafts and are concerned about the optic still performing if it is submerged in water and you can still find the rifle.
Info Around Rifle Optic Tube Gas Purging
Another part of preventing the buildup of wetness inside of the rifle scope’s tube is filling the tube with a gas like nitrogen. Given that this area is currently taken up by the gas, the glass is less affected by climate alterations and pressure distinctions from the outside environment which might potentially enable water vapor to permeate in around the seals to fill the vacuum which would otherwise exist. These are good qualities of a decent rifle scope to seek out.
